What are the primary functions of box muffle furnaces in high-temperature chemical laboratory heat treatment processes?


The box muffle furnace is the cornerstone of high-temperature laboratory precision. It functions primarily as a controlled environment for inducing critical physical and chemical transformations such as sintering, ashing, annealing, and roasting. By isolating samples from heating elements and providing uniform thermal fields, it ensures the integrity of crystal structures and the repeatability of complex chemical reactions at temperatures often exceeding 1000°C.

A box muffle furnace provides a highly controlled, isolated thermal environment essential for material phase transformations and purification. It bridges the gap between raw chemical powders and high-performance materials through precise temperature regulation and uniform heat distribution.

Facilitating Material Phase Transformations

Sintering of Ceramics and Powders

The furnace is essential for sintering, a process where powdered materials are heated below their melting point to form a solid mass. This is critical in the preparation of ceramic materials, where the furnace facilitates the fusion of particles into a dense, structural whole.

Calcination and Roasting

Laboratory furnaces are used for calcination to induce thermal decomposition or remove volatile fractions from mineral ores and chemical compounds. Similarly, roasting facilitates gas-solid reactions, which is a fundamental step in the preparation of catalysts and the processing of various chemical reagents.

Solid-Phase Reactions

Muffle furnaces provide the sustained, high-temperature environment required for high-temperature solid-phase reactions. These reactions allow for the synthesis of new compounds by facilitating atomic diffusion between solid precursors under specific thermal field conditions.

Analytical and Purification Processes

Quantitative Sample Ashing

One of the most common laboratory functions is ashing, the removal of organic components from a sample to isolate its inorganic constituents. This process is vital for analytical chemistry, allowing researchers to determine the mineral content of a substance without interference from combustible matter.

Melting, Fusion, and Purification

Furnaces are utilized for the melting and fusion of substances to study material behavior or to refine metals and glass. These processes often involve purification, where high heat is used to drive off impurities, resulting in a target product with specific performance characteristics.

Annealing and Stress Relief

In material science, the furnace performs annealing, a heat treatment that alters the physical properties of a material to increase its ductility and reduce its hardness. This is achieved by carefully controlling the heating and cooling curves to modify the material's internal crystal structure.

Ensuring Experimental Integrity

Thermal Uniformity and Repeatability

A high-quality muffle furnace provides a uniform thermal field, ensuring that the entire sample experiences the same temperature distribution. This uniformity is critical for the repeatability of experimental results, allowing researchers to confirm that observed changes are due to the temperature setpoint rather than localized hot spots.

Sample Isolation and Purity

The "muffle" design specifically isolates the sample from direct contact with heating elements or combustion gases. This isolation is vital for maintaining sample purity, as it prevents contamination from the heating source during sensitive chemical reactions.

Understanding Technical Limitations

Thermal Inertia and Cooling Rates

Box furnaces often possess significant thermal mass, meaning they heat up and cool down slowly. While this aids in stability, it can be a disadvantage for processes requiring rapid thermal cycling or precise quenching.

Atmospheric Limitations

Standard muffle furnaces are designed for air atmospheres; without specialized modifications, they cannot easily support vacuum or inert gas environments. Using a standard furnace for materials prone to oxidation at high temperatures can result in unwanted chemical side reactions.

Choosing the Right Furnace for Your Application

Selecting the appropriate equipment depends entirely on the chemical sensitivity and thermal requirements of your specific research project.

  • If your primary focus is material purity: Prioritize a furnace with high-quality refractory lining and a design that ensures total isolation from the heating elements.
  • If your primary focus is ceramic synthesis: Focus on models offering high-precision temperature controllers capable of programming complex, multi-stage heating and cooling ramps.
  • If your primary focus is analytical ashing: Ensure the unit features adequate ventilation or exhaust ports to safely remove the gases generated during the combustion of organic matter.

By matching the specific thermal capabilities of a box muffle furnace to your chemical process, you ensure both the safety of the laboratory and the integrity of your scientific data.
